PURPOSE: A dynamic characteristic analysis apparatus of a super speed air bearing spindle is provided to systematically analyze the effect that rotation speed, rotation unbalance, air pressure, and load capacity exert on the dynamic characteristic of a spindle.;CONSTITUTION: A dynamic characteristic analysis apparatus of a super speed air bearing spindle is composed of a shaft, a BLDC(Brushless Direct Current) motor(20), a housing(30), an air supply unit(40), a humidity control unit(50), a vibration sensing unit(60), a signal processing unit(70), a display unit(80), and a load applying device(100). The vibration sensing unit is installed in the housing of a spindle. The vibration sensing unit measures the radial vibration about the shaft of the spindle. The signal processing unit removes the noises of the electric signal generated in the vibration sensing unit, amplifies the signal, and converts the analog signal to the digital signal. The display unit displays data about the vibration obtained from the signal processing unit. The load applying device applies the load to the end(E) of the shaft horizontally and axially.;COPYRIGHT KIPO 2010
